Filters:
clear
medical spa
clear
Norton, Massachusetts
clear
Country: United States

medical spa in Norton, Massachusetts

About 1 results.

Ananda Medical Aesthetics and Laser Spa

thumb_up 133 likes
favorite 10 favorites
85 E Main St, Suite B, 02766 Norton, United States

Contact Ananda Medical Aesthetics and Laser Spa to schedule a free consultation with their skilled Massachusetts nurses and skin care professionals.

  • 1